Método IStiUSD::LockDevice (stiusd.h)

Um método IStiUSD::LockDevice de um minidriver de imagem ainda bloqueia um dispositivo para uso exclusivo pelo chamador.

Sintaxe

HRESULT LockDevice();

Retornar valor

Se a operação for bem-sucedida, o método deverá retornar S_OK. Caso contrário, ele deverá retornar um dos códigos de erro prefixados por STIERR definidos em stierr.h.

Comentários

Se você estiver escrevendo um driver para um dispositivo conectado a uma porta serial, talvez queira chamar CreateFile de dentro do método IStiUSD::LockDevice do driver se o dispositivo tiver sido aberto no modo status. Isso proibirá outros aplicativos de usar a porta (que pode dar suporte a outros dispositivos) enquanto status informações estiverem sendo obtidas. Para obter mais informações, consulte Modos de transferência.

Requisitos

Requisito Valor
Plataforma de Destino Área de Trabalho
Cabeçalho stiusd.h (inclua Stiusd.h)

Confira também

IStiDevice::LockDevice

IStiUSD